From 2013 to 2023, the accident insurance market in Germany experienced fluctuations. Starting at 462 units in 2013, it peaked at 466 in 2014 before gradually declining to 416 in 2023. Remarkably, 2020 saw a significant dip of 6.1%. While the value rebounded in 2022, this was short-lived as it dropped again the following year.
The compounded annual growth rate (CAGR) over the past five years was a consistent decline, with the last five years showing an average yearly decrease of 0.98%. This demonstrates an overall downtrend in the market.
Future trends predict a continued decline with a forecasted five-year CAGR of -0.8%, implying a longer-term contraction in the market. By 2028, the market is expected to reach 393.92 units, reflecting a 3.95% decrease from 2023.
